Property Tax Analysis

Property Tax Insights for ZIP 98223

Property owners in ZIP code 98223 (Arlington, Washington) pay a median of $4,074/year in property taxes on homes valued at $556,900. This translates to an effective tax rate of 0.73%, which is 4% below the Washington state average of 0.77%.

The monthly property tax burden for a median-valued home in 98223 is approximately $340, which factors into escrow payments on mortgages. This ZIP code is located within Snohomish County. This is $482 more than the Washington average of $3,592/year.

Compared to similar ZIP codes in Washington, 98223 has lower property taxes. ZIP codes with similar effective rates include 98102 (0.73%) and 99103 (0.73%).

In Arlington, property taxes represent approximately 4.2% of the median household income of $96,478, providing context for the relative tax burden on homeowners in this area.

Washington does not cap property tax increases; Snohomish County Assessor revalues your home at sale to current market value with no state limit on assessment growth. Snohomish County residents age 61+ or disabled with income below the state threshold (roughly $40,000–$45,000) may qualify for the Senior/Disabled Property Tax Exemption — contact the county assessor's office or visit snohomishcounty.us to apply. File your exemption application with the Snohomish County Assessor by March 31 of the year you wish the exemption to take effect to secure immediate tax relief.

Margin of Error

The median property tax estimate for this ZIP code has a margin of error of ±$254. ZCTA-level data has wider margins than county-level estimates due to smaller sample sizes.
